Iran Conflict began 28 Feb 2026 — Day 12 of monitoring
Pre-conflict baseline · Jan 6 – Feb 27 (53 days)
Post-conflict window · Feb 28 – Mar 14 (15 days)
Ramadan began · Feb 18 · negligible seasonal effect (−3.7% New in 2024)
Airspace status · Partial closure — inbound migration suppressed
City-wide Impact Summary
New Contracts / Day
Pre-conflict avg 851.6 /day

Post-conflict avg 563.1 /day
▼ 33.9%
Renewed Contracts / Day
Pre-conflict avg 1,397.9 /day

Post-conflict avg 1,112.1 /day
▼ 20.4%
Total Contracts / Day
Pre-conflict avg 2,249.5 /day

Post-conflict avg 1,675.2 /day
▼ 25.5%
Signal Interpretation

New −33.9% reflects inbound migration halt — airspace closure preventing new arrivals

Renewals −20.4% — concerning; renewals are contractually driven. Suggests residents hedging or departing
